how is gender seen amongst uniimas or even any other sentient species, do they take an example of humans? do they even have a concept of it. srry if this is strange
Not a strange question, very good question actually.
For uniima c, our concept of gender is something of a taboo. Just like us, they are bi-sex, but unlike us, they have 0 sexual dimorphism and it's impossible to tell someone's sex on sight. This means that they also don't have a concept of homosexuality or heterosexuality but many pairs can't have children. Adoption is very common and families will trade eggs or get them from the community "birther".
There's nothing like our gender in Uniima c society but they do have ranks and gender-like stereotypes based on "courting traditions/rituals/skills". It's usually an artistic expression that is inherently romantic.

(Uniima ll have a very similar system but in some areas they have less rules and take some sloman inspiration)
For O.s, sexual gender doesn't exist at all, and in non-humanoid O.s no gender exists. For human O.s however, the concept of femininity and masculinity exists and they often choose an identity based on this. It is partially their own invention and partially inspired by elven/slomen.
For Slomen gender is actually less binary than for O.s. The females are usually bigger with bigger authority and males have bigger display features (I have not drawn that at the time of this post) but transgenderism is not a new concept in any way and is in most places accepted as nothing unusual. The average recognized set of genders is about 5. Some genders have spiritual meanings as well.
The stars are not yet very developed by me but they are very strict about sex and gender.

do the uniima not chew their food at all if they hold both the plates and utensils with their 2nd jaw? Do they have strong stomachs that prevent them from choking or are they are certain to always eat small or mushy food that makes it a non issue? Do they have strong stomachs that mean they never have to really worry about choking

It's true Uniima generally prefer soft foods like fruit and eat many mushy things but they can chew too.
While using their beak and "tongue hands" for manipulation, they have adapted their secondary mechanisms for processing.
Because breathing and digestive system is completely separated, Uniima and their ancestors have lot of control over their throat and bonus organs to get rid of things or push things farther. The clade that Uniima belong to have different levels of tooth covering in these parts.
This back "jaw" is not the strongest because it's not as well jointed or muscular for chewing but it does get the job done. Most of the remains will get finished by the stomach acids that are still stronger than those of a human because of the uniima wyvern ancestry (true wyverns generally swallow large prey whole).

A small show of some very different central states uniima clothing. This is very small sample with only 3 and 4 being more universal.
From left to right - traveling representative, "egg master"/"gender supreme", pilot, casual commoner.
Fashion is very important for central and many other Uniima. All non casual clothing is custom made and rather than fitting a style it's designed to compete with other styles. This means very fast changes. Smaller communities like towns will have more uniform styles as they might have their own fashion guild that wants to be the best one.
Colors are also a VERY important part of fashion and even commoners will add some to their casual dress. I made this image more plain because that sort of stuff is personal. For the "egg master", white is usually the color of birth and life and is rarely personalized (but can show the wearer's accomplishments).
It follows these standards.

In many states, almost every outfit has a sort of skeleton that other pieces of clothing are attached to. It also serves as the underwear.
This allows the more flowy and loose fabric to stay controlled even when climbing.

While very varied among communities, centrals often hide more body with more layers and firm cloth than other regions which is partially because they are exposed to more sunlight and need protection from it. Doing "strategical" tree cutting for material and expansion, their lands have turned drier and sunnier. They still live mostly on trees but strongly manage the territory.

Uniiman mount. They are present in almost every region either for travel or silk or both.
Something I forgot to add is their face plate rotates depending on how their body is angled. It's limited in movement but it gives the animal better spacial awareness. They have few eyes spots in their armor too but less sensitive.
More to their biology - while looking like a giant lobster they come from the same "fish" ancestors as Uniima. They belong to a group that kept their 3rd pair of limbs for locomotion, though these limbs are more specilised than the rest (in uniima the 3rd pair is part of their internal organs).

These are the Heads - the mostly spiritual leader of the central Foru micro-state collective. Their role is to be a guide for all the leaders (archs) in central Foru and speak for all of them on an international level. They also bless lands and people and generally are well-liked by them. They can make big decisions, but it's ultimately on the archs if they comply (but the pressure is strong).
Every head has a more specialized role, each representing a 'sense' of their one shared soul (hearing, seeing, touch, thought...) and people they are patrons to (the old, the "rich", the leaders, the priests...). Each central Foru micro-state usually has its favorite head that they want to see the most in their community when bringing them news or blessings.
here are closeups




The Heads are the center of a religion practiced in the region. In short - the Heads share one spirit that in ancient times belonged to a priest who misused their power to get to the spirit world and instead became forever stuck in the material world. After many reincarnations, the priest became a wise leader who learned to speak with the spirit world and make final peace between the worlds of spirits and the material.
I would need to go into more religion details to go over that but that can be a separate post. Let's talk about how they get their role.

A 'competition' is held to determine the best leader, most spiritually attuned, most well-thinking, and best-presenting individual. The Heads in position at the time with a few other high-ranking individuals will judge the participants and then make their pick at the choosing ceremony. Luckily there are not too many to choose from, there are many requirements to participate.

However, the one picked isn't one that will become a head, they would be far too old at the time. Instead, they will force their system to make a rare phenomenon happen. This means making more of themselves with cloning (having babies grow out of diploid cells with no need for another person). This is usually achieved when under high amounts of stress and loneliness.

The uniima egg naturally holds 4 larvae but usually only 1-2 develop fully while the rest becomes food for the surviving ones. This clone egg has 4 identical whites (pre-babies) in them that get special care to ensure at least 3 survive. There have been heads with one member before and with 2 and 3, but 4 is a miracle as the bottom corner larva almost never develops enough to hatch. This egg is very lucky.

The identical quadruplets are given to be raised in different environments. These environments will decide what they represent as adults. It will also give them better perspectives of the world, making it easier/more difficult to make big decisions when the time comes.
Additionally, because there are 4 heads this time, a new environment had to be introduced. This environment was that of small communities, minorities, and generally people living in poorer conditions (yes, for the past Heads, war was more important than their people suffering (it's a very central Foru thing)). Unfortunately for The Ear, they are not respected everywhere, and many people assume them to be a fake among their siblings.
You can also see the heads have each their own signature and each Head generation has their own symbol that is recognized outside their writing systems.

Which one of your creatures tastes best when cooked?

I was planning to do a bit more than this but sadly my mind is not doing the thing (the focus). Also- the "tastes the best" here only applies to some people of a single species.
This is a parasitic fruit (it does not aid in reproduction of the plant) you only really see once a year. It's often hard to spot and even harder to harvest at the right time as it's one of the few mobile fruits that changes its host plant regularly. (And when ripe it explodes and rots away very fast.)
However, because of its size, rarity, and traits, it's considered a delicacy. If you were to compare it to human foods, this fruit is fatty, very sweet and the bottom part can taste quite meatlike.
It's best served steamed or 'grilled' with raw eggsseeds. No seasoning added. Don't overcook it or it becomes mushy inside.
Can be made into gourmand alcohol.
Foru flora fruit reproduction - for context: The fruit of Foru trees is alive. Small flying animals, sometimes difficult to see with a naked eye, spread 'pollen' (sometimes also spores/seeds) of plants and later some of them attach themselves to a new plant. There they begin injecting the plant with signals that make it start feeding them. As the small organism matures it loses its eyes, legs and stops producing wastes. The plant, now connected firmly to the animal grows it's seeds inside the animal, using it as protection and 'incubator' of those seeds. In the meanwhile the fruit also gets fertilized and produces eggs in its top layer. While it depends on species, most often a ripe fruit dies and opens its back to release hundreds of small frying creatures. The remaining fruit might get eaten by another animal or fall on a comfy spot where seeds can start growing.
These designs might not be final. Still working out Foru flora.

On the left, an older caretaker from some island culture. Sleepy babies get to hold on the adult's piercings. The ones too young get a ride in the basket.
On the right, an egg arch (a reproductive leader) of a coastal culture. The babies on their neck don't have the balance to walk but might not be so sleepy. Unlike the caretaker the arch carries their own children. They make great accessories but being your parent's keychains is also a good exercise, experts say.
Climbing on big uniimas is natural to a baby. Since uniima are evolved to be arboreal, it's better they can climb and grip as soon as possible. Their giant heads make it easy to hold their full weight on their jaws.
Before becoming a parent or a caretaker, one needs to realize they will also become a tree, a mountain, and a hanger.
